A finite graph is a graph that has a limited number of vertices and edges, meaning it can be completely represented and counted. In contrast, an infinite graph has an unbounded number of vertices or edges, making it impossible to fully represent in a finite manner. Infinite graphs often arise in theoretical contexts, such as in discussions of limits or in certain mathematical structures, while finite graphs are commonly used in practical applications like network modeling.

A graph with finite data is one that represents a limited number of discrete points or values. For example, a bar graph illustrating the number of students in different classes at a school is finite, as it only includes specific, countable data points. Similarly, a scatter plot showing the relationship between two variables collected from a survey of a fixed number of respondents is also finite. In contrast, a continuous graph, like a sine wave, represents an infinite set of data points.
In a speed graph, a straight vertical line represents an infinite speed, which is not physically possible. Such a line would imply that an object is covering a distance instantaneously over a finite time interval, violating the principles of physics. Therefore, a speed graph cannot have a straight vertical line.
